Chris Christie is as a toxic as a NJ Superfund Site

Last edited Mon Oct 30, 2017, 03:10 PM - Edit history (1)

Kim Guadagno, the NJ Lt. Governor, is running for governor and running away from Governor Christie during her campaign.

He has not been asked to make speeches or appearances on her behalf. No commercials. No endorsements.

If anything, the only time Christie is mentioned, it's by her democratic opponent, Phil Murphy, and nearly every democratic candidate for state Assembly and Senate. And used to score political points for them.

This is the man who won a "landslide" during re-election four years ago. Who believed he could parlay his popularity to New Hampshire and then to the White House.
